Grill the Fish
Preheat a grill or grill pan over medium heat. Grill the marinated fish fillets for about 3-4 minutes on each side, or until fully cooked and flaky. Remove from heat and let cool slightly before flaking into bite-sized pieces.

Make the Slaw
In a large bowl, combine shredded green cabbage, grated carrot, chopped cilantro, lime juice, and salt. Toss everything together until the cabbage and carrot are well coated in the dressing. Set aside.

Prepare the Chipotle Mayo
In a small bowl, mix together the mayonnaise, minced chipotle in adobo sauce, lime juice, and salt until fully combined. Adjust seasoning to taste.

Assemble the Tacos
Warm the corn tortillas on a skillet for about 30 seconds on each side. Fill each tortilla with a portion of grilled fish, top with cabbage slaw, and drizzle with chipotle mayo. Serve immediately.
